Safety PLC

Definition:
A Safety PLC (programmable logic controller) is a programmable device designed to perform logic operations for Safety Instrumented Functions (SIFs) and certified for specific SIL ratings. This means that both the hardware and software as well as the diagnostic coverage are independently verified. Safety PLCs are a step up from a Safety Module and a big step up from Relay Logic.

A safety PLC is a common logic solver in a SIF. But a logic solver does not have to be a safety PLC.

A safety PLC is a good choice for large and complicated SISs. It is arguably over-complicated for a simple SIS with only a few SIFs.

Note that a safety PLC is somewhat of a loose term. Often people say the logic solver in a SIF is a safety PLC but a safety PLC is arguably more of a PLC carrying a certain certification. Safety PLCs can be used in manufacturing or in machinery safety if the engineering for that system requires it. Some brands of PLCs often visually distinguish safety PLCs from others, such as a certain color. Yellow is a common color for Siemens and Allen Bradley.

Key Points:

  • A safety PLC must meet requirements of IEC 61508 Parts 2 and 3.
  • Often redundant and fault-tolerant.
  • Often it is yellow depending on the brand.

Example:
A Triconex SIL 3 PLC used in emergency shutdown systems would be a safety PLC This could handle multiple SIFs.
